India’s forex kitty drops by $11.41 billion to $698.346 billion
28-Mar-2026

India’s foreign exchange reserves fell sharply by USD 11.41 billion to USD 698.34 billion in the week ending March 20, according to data released by the Reserve Bank of India. This drop follows a previous decline of USD 7.05 billion in the week before, when reserves stood at USD 709.76 billion. Earlier this year, reserves had reached a record high of USD 728.49 billion in late February. The main reason for the latest fall was a steep decrease in gold reserves. The value of gold holdings dropped by USD 13.49 billion to USD 117.19 billion during the week.
